Transaction d667e25ed9de8e65b12d9a3c59b219ba1b3c25c19de4871883ee6e6ae7da87ae

34 Input
2 Outputs
  • d667e25ed9de8e65b12d9a3c59b219ba1b3c25c19de4871883ee6e6ae7da87ae:0
  • value  55517
    address  bc1qhmzr8dplqraldrv7xcs8gq0uwjq0urdtvmntwq
  • d667e25ed9de8e65b12d9a3c59b219ba1b3c25c19de4871883ee6e6ae7da87ae:1
  • value  17780280
    address  1LfhuJULxYYpomaKyHt5DGxZShr3eBkXPM